WebThe Smith chart provides a way to find this impedance. Once the impedance is known, an impedance-matching circuit can be added to compensate for the conditions and make the line flat and the SWR as close to 1 as possible. WebEE331 — Basic Smith Chart Information 1. To find the SWR , draw a circle (“the SWR circle”) centered at the origin of th e Γr–Γi plane through the normalized load impedance zL. The SWR is the value where the circle intersects the positive real …
